| Barwon NDIS trial finally gets green light |
| Monday, 13 August 2012 08:20 |
|
The Barwon region will host one of five trials, giving five-thousand local people who live with a disability more choice over the standard and quality of care they receive. Federal Disability Reform Minister Jenny Macklin says it'll start in the middle of next year: or listen here Geelong is the fifth region around the country to host a trial. The others are in Tasmania, South Australia, NSW and the ACT. |
